网络流量分析工具如何进行数据收集?

在信息化时代,网络流量分析工具已成为网络安全和运维不可或缺的利器。通过分析网络流量,我们可以了解网络的使用情况,及时发现异常行为,保障网络安全。那么,网络流量分析工具是如何进行数据收集的呢?本文将深入探讨这一话题。

一、数据收集方法

  1. 被动式数据收集

被动式数据收集是指网络流量分析工具在不干扰网络正常运作的情况下,对网络中的数据包进行监听和分析。以下是几种常见的被动式数据收集方法:

  • 镜像技术:将网络中的数据包复制到分析工具中,以便后续分析。
  • 端口镜像:将网络设备上的指定端口的数据包复制到分析工具中。
  • SPAN技术:将网络交换机上的数据包复制到分析工具中。

  1. 主动式数据收集

主动式数据收集是指网络流量分析工具主动向网络中的设备发送请求,获取数据信息。以下是几种常见的主动式数据收集方法:

  • 网络抓包:通过分析工具向网络设备发送抓包指令,获取数据包信息。
  • 流量生成:通过分析工具向网络设备发送流量,以获取网络使用情况。
  • 数据包重传:通过分析工具向网络设备发送数据包,并要求设备重传,以获取数据包详细信息。

二、数据收集过程

  1. 数据采集

数据采集是数据收集的第一步,主要包括以下几个方面:

  • 网络拓扑结构:了解网络中各个设备之间的关系,以便分析数据包的传输路径。
  • 设备信息:收集网络设备的型号、操作系统、IP地址等信息,以便分析数据包的来源和目的。
  • 流量特征:收集网络流量的大小、类型、频率等信息,以便分析网络使用情况。

  1. 数据预处理

数据预处理是指对采集到的原始数据进行清洗、过滤和转换,以便后续分析。以下是几种常见的数据预处理方法:

  • 数据清洗:去除无效、重复、错误的数据。
  • 数据过滤:根据需求过滤掉无关的数据。
  • 数据转换:将数据转换为便于分析的形式。

  1. 数据分析

数据分析是数据收集的核心环节,主要包括以下几个方面:

  • 流量分析:分析网络流量的大小、类型、频率等信息,了解网络使用情况。
  • 协议分析:分析数据包的协议类型、端口信息等,了解网络应用情况。
  • 异常检测:识别网络中的异常行为,如DDoS攻击、恶意软件传播等。

三、案例分析

以某企业网络为例,通过网络流量分析工具发现以下异常情况:

  1. 异常流量:分析工具发现企业网络中存在大量异常流量,经调查发现是恶意软件传播所致。
  2. 端口扫描:分析工具发现企业网络中存在端口扫描行为,经调查发现是黑客企图入侵企业网络。
  3. 数据泄露:分析工具发现企业网络中存在数据泄露现象,经调查发现是内部员工违规操作所致。

通过以上案例分析,可以看出网络流量分析工具在网络安全和运维中的重要作用。

总之,网络流量分析工具通过被动式和主动式数据收集方法,对网络流量进行采集、预处理和分析,以保障网络安全和运维。了解网络流量分析工具的数据收集过程,有助于我们更好地利用这一工具,提升网络安全防护能力。

猜你喜欢:SkyWalking